我想将AdomdClient引用添加到C#项目中,但它不在引用列表中。 客户端列在程序集文件夹C:\ Windows \ assembly。
中在计算机上安装了SQL Server 2012.
答案 0 :(得分:1)
答案 1 :(得分:0)
在我的计算机上,我可以在
找到SQL Server 2008的参考资料c:\Program Files (x86)\Microsoft SQL Server\100\DTS\PipelineComponents\Microsoft.AnalysisServices.AdomdClient.dll
对于SQL Server 2012,我认为版本(目录“100”)会更高,可能是“110”。该位置有点奇怪,因为它适用于Integration Services数据流组件,但我刚刚检查了另一台安装了SQL Server 2008的计算机,并且该文件位于同一位置。
答案 2 :(得分:0)
如果您在解决方案中需要它,并且知道位置(如您所示,在c:\ windows \ assembly中),请右键单击Visual Studio中解决方案资源管理器中的“引用”节点,然后单击“添加引用”。单击“浏览”按钮,找到您的DLL文件,然后单击对话框中的“添加”。它应该显示在您的参考列表中。然后,您应该能够在C#文件中引用它。
如果您没有方便的ADOMD客户端DLL文件,请从Microsoft SQL Server 2012 Feature Pack(http://www.microsoft.com/en-us/download/details.aspx?id=29065)下载它。单击“安装说明”并查找“Microsoft®SQLServer®2012ADOMD.NET”
答案 3 :(得分:0)
解决方案是here.
1)添加Microsoft.AnalysisServices.dll 浏览到C:\ Program Files(x86)\ Microsoft SQL Server \ 100 \ SDK \ Assemblies \ Microsoft.AnalysisServices.dll
2)添加Microsoft.AnalysisServices.AdomdClient 浏览到C:\ Program Files \ Microsoft.NET \ ADOMD.NET \ 100 \ Microsoft.AnalysisServices.AdomdClient.dll
答案 4 :(得分:0)
Microsoft.AnalysisServices.AdomdClient
已弃用,不应根据 NuGet 页面使用。
Install-Package Unofficial.Microsoft.AnalysisServices.AdomdClient